140 % Accept both English "Yes" and French "Oui" as Canada is bilingual.
141 yesexpr "<U005E><U005B><U002B><U0031><U0079><U0059><U006F><U004F><U005D>"
142 % Accept both Engish "No" and French "Non" as Canada is bilingual.
143 noexpr "<U005E><U005B><U002D><U0030><U006E><U004E><U005D>"
144 % yes - Display only the English "yes". While Canada is bilingual it would be
145 % difficult to display two words e.g. yes|oui, where one word is expected.
146 % Thus given that the majority of the population is Anglophone we use only
147 % the English word for yesstr.
148 yesstr "<U0079><U0065><U0073>"
149 % no - Display only the English "no". See the rationale for yesstr.
150 nostr "<U006E><U006F>"
